Are there hidden costs when working with a Cloud Services company in Sudan on Cloud Migration?
With reputable Cloud Services companies in Sudan, hidden costs are avoidable if you ask the right questions during proposal review before signing the contract. Clarify upfront whether project management, QA and testing, deployment, staging environment setup, and third-party Cloud Migration tool licensing are included in the quoted price or billed additionally as out-of-pocket expenses. Also confirm in writing how post-launch defect fixes are handled — whether they fall within a warranty period or require a separate maintenance retainer — before committing to any Cloud Services firm in Sudan for your Cloud Migration engagement.

How do Cloud Services companies in Sudan protect the intellectual property created in my Cloud Migration project?
Established Cloud Services companies in Sudan protect client Cloud Migration IP through explicit IP assignment clauses in the main contract, comprehensive NDAs signed by all project team members, and strict repository access controls that limit code exposure to only those directly involved in Cloud Migration delivery. All source code, design files, documentation, and third-party licenses are transferred to the client upon final payment, with no residual claim retained by the Cloud Services firm. Before project kickoff, ask that the contract includes a clause confirming no pre-existing Cloud Services company IP is embedded in your Cloud Migration deliverables without your prior written consent.
